Ads may not appear when is blocked by fingerprinting blocking


Affected versions

  • latest Nightly 68.0a1
  • latest Beta 67.0b11

Affected platforms

  • Windows 10 x64
  • macOS 10.13
  • Ubuntu 18.04 x64


  • Go to about:config and change urlclassifier.features.fingerprinting.blacklistTables to base-fingerprinting-track-digest256,content-fingerprinting-track-digest256
  • Go to about:url-classifier and click “Trigger Update” in the mozilla row under the “Provider” heading.

Steps to reproduce

  1. Go to about:preferences#privacy and from Custom section un-check all items expect for "Fingerprinters".
  2. Access

Expected result

  • The top ad is NOT blocked on the webpage.

Actual result

  • The top ad is blocked on the webpage.

Regression range

  • Not a regression, I was able to reproduce this on older Nightly build 67.01 (20190211215545) as well, which is one of the first builds with this feature implemented.

Additional notes

  • please observe the attached screenshot.

Steven, do you have time to investigate this issue? This is similar to bug 1545044.

It's difficult to determine exactly which blocklist rule caused ads not to appear in comment 0 since different ad placements load with each new page load. I tried reloading this page a bunch of times and the only time I saw ads fail to load was when was blocked. Let's use this bug to collect examples of breakage due to DoubleVerify blocking.

Summary: Missing the top ad on if Fingerprinters are enabled → Ads may not appear when is blocked by fingerprinting blocking

If the issue is still reproducible, can you send us the log of firefox, generated by MOZ_LOG=AntiTracking:5,nsChannelClassifier:5 ?

Attached file ad-fail.txt.moz_log

The issue is still preset, but in my case seem to be the domain that blocks the ad from being displayed. I've attached the logs.

